From c0d5e2a0c8ea363e7081ed1666e43e13bddd4ea6 Mon Sep 17 00:00:00 2001 From: superp00t Date: Fri, 24 Nov 2023 23:52:34 -0500 Subject: [PATCH] feat(gx): GLSDL window closes upon SDL_EVENT_QUIT --- src/gx/glsdl/GLSDLWindow.cpp | 2 ++ 1 file changed, 2 insertions(+) diff --git a/src/gx/glsdl/GLSDLWindow.cpp b/src/gx/glsdl/GLSDLWindow.cpp index ed473d8..04f7261 100644 --- a/src/gx/glsdl/GLSDLWindow.cpp +++ b/src/gx/glsdl/GLSDLWindow.cpp @@ -1,6 +1,7 @@ #include "gx/glsdl/GLSDLWindow.hpp" #include "event/Types.hpp" #include "event/Input.hpp" +#include "event/Event.hpp" #include #include @@ -282,6 +283,7 @@ void GLSDLWindow::DispatchSDLEvent(const SDL_Event& event) { this->DispatchSDLMouseMotionEvent(event); break; case SDL_EVENT_QUIT: + EventPostClose(); break; default: break;